Long Lane is a quiet lane tucked behind the main thoroughfare of Broughty Ferry, running just a short walk from the castle, the beach, and the restaurants and bars that make the Ferry one of the most desirable places to live. It's a street that most people walk past without a second glance, which makes finding a home here feel like something of a discovery.
164A is a ground floor apartment that has been completely transformed. Re-wired, re-plumbed, new gas central heating, new everything. The result is a home that feels entirely at odds with what you might expect from a property of this type. Every decision has been made with quality in mind, and it shows.
The kitchen is a full fitted installation in contemporary slate grey, with integrated appliances including oven, induction hob, dishwasher and washing machine. A geometric tile splashback adds a considered design touch without overplaying it. The open plan layout allows the kitchen and living area to work as a single connected space, light and clean throughout.
The bedroom is compact but well considered, with fitted overhead storage built around the bed head making excellent use of the space. The shower room is the room that stops people. Large format stone-effect tiling, a Hansgrohe rainfall system with thermostatic controls, a wall-hung vanity unit and an illuminated mirror. It belongs in a home worth considerably more.
This is a home for a discerning first-time buyer who wants quality over size, or someone looking to downsize without compromising on finish. Properties renovated to this standard at this price point in the Ferry are rare. Fifty metres from the beach. Right in the heart of it all.
